The Pickup Place / Which DiMarzio is closest to SD Custom?
« on: April 29, 2018, 02:00:48 PM »
I have an early 90's Charvel Fusion Plus with a Duncan Custom in the bridge position.  I like the sound, but it is the regular spaced version and my guitar has a Floyd bridge, so I would like to replace it with an F-spaced pup.  I would like the closest DiMarzio equivalent, as I am planning on going with an Evolution or Gravity Storm Neck and would like to keep it in the family.  Duncan does not seem to offer as wide of a selection of higher output neck pups as DiMarzio and I need a higher output neck pup to match better with the higher output bridge pup and that also splits well.  This particular guitar is my 80's Hair Band/EVH Super Strat.  Ash body, rosewood board, maple neck, Floyd, but with 24.75" "Gibson" scale length.

The Pickup Place / PUP recommendation for 91 Charvel Fusion Plus
« on: April 20, 2018, 10:44:46 PM »
Need pup recommendation for a 91' Charvel Fusion Plus.  It has 24 frets, maple neck, rosewood fingerboard, ash body, dual humbuckers, Jackson JT-590 Schaller licenced Floyd Rose bridge.  Crucially, this guitar is a "Fusion" between a Strat and a Gibson; i.e., Strat body and vibrato bridge, but Gibson dual hum configuration and "short" 24.75" Gibson scale length.

This guitar will be my primary 80's EVH and Hair Metal axe, but also will be used for classic 70's Hard Rock.

It has a 5-way super switch to select pups, which gives multiple combinations of humbucking and split coil tones, so both pups need to have enough output to produce convincing single coil tones when split.

Current pups are very high output active Reflex Silver pups, which have great sustain for single note instrumental rock melody lines, but are too compressed for what I play.  I need more attack and punch for rhythm work.  Also, when I turn the active tone control up past the flat detent, the bridge pup becomes very harsh, but if tone is flat or cut, there is not enough bite and cut.

Any suggestions would be appreciated
